                Mars Odyssey GRS Special Products.
                
                The Odyssey Gamma Ray Spectrometer (GRS) special data products are derived data acquired by the
                Gamma Ray Subsystem -- the Gamma Sensor Head (GSH), the Neutron Spectrometer (NS), and the
                High Energy Neutron Detector (HEND).
                
                The Odyssey GRS Science Team released this set of special derived products to accompany the
                October 1, 2002, release of EDRs (raw data). These products include global maps of neutron flux and
                portions of gamma-ray spectra showing hydrogen peaks. Figures in Science articles published in 2002 by
                the GRS Team were based on these data.
